Dr. Jay Harmon is the Director of Agriculture and Natural Resources Extension and Associate Dean for Extension Programs and Outreach in the College of Agriculture and Life Sciences.  In this role, he oversees agricultural and natural resource Extension programs conducted throughout the state of Iowa.  This includes 10 Plan of Work teams, approximately 43 field specialists, 43 faculty and 60 staff.  He has been in this role since April, 2017. 

He is also a professor of agricultural and biosystems engineering and served as an extension livestock housing specialist.   In his role he conducted extension programs and did research on ventilation, air quality, facility design and other areas related mostly to the swine industry.  He taught wood structures, capstone design and animal facilities courses at various times in his career.

Dr. Harmon, who is originally from Indiana, holds degrees from Purdue, Minnesota and Virginia Tech.  He is a licensed professional engineer.   He is also a member of the Rural Builders Hall of Fame and a Fellow in the American Society of Agricultural and Biological Engineers.  He has held a position at Iowa State University since 1993 and worked at Clemson University from 1989-1993.
